What should I look for when buying a Auto Repair business?

Key signals for a high-quality auto repair acquisition include: long owner tenure (15+ years operating the same business), stable recurring or repeat revenue, strong online ratings (4.0+ with 20+ reviews), an established local customer base, and a skilled technical workforce. What is the typical asking price for a Auto Repair business in British Columbia?

Auto Repair businesses in British Columbia typically trade at 3x to 6x EBITDA, depending on revenue concentration, customer contracts, and owner dependency. A business with $2M revenue and 12% EBITDA margins ($240k EBITDA) would price between $720k and $1.44M. Businesses with recurring contracts, long owner tenure, and clean books command higher multiples.
